Summary
Activate Learning is looking for an HR Services Adviser to join our collaborative HR Services team in Oxford. This is an exciting opportunity to play a key role in supporting essential HR processes that underpin our staff journey.Working within a busy front-line HR Services team, you’ll deliver a professional, high-quality, and customer-focused service. Your responsibilities will include, managing every aspect of the onboarding and offboarding process, ensuring onboarding of all new staff meets legal requirements and adheres to safer recruitment practices and recruitment policies and procedures. Manage the HR Service Desk, on a rota basis, ensuring that all requests are dealt with in a timely and accurate manner.In addition, you will respond promptly to HR queries, provide excellent customer service, and contribute to process improvements that enhance team efficiency. This is a fast-paced environment where attention to detail and the ability to meet deadlines are essential.This is a fixed-term, full-time role (37 hours per week), offering a hybrid working model with flexibility based at our Oxford College. This is a maternity cover position until January 2027.What do you need to be successful as an HR Services Adviser at Activate Learning?Previous experience in an HR role (HR Administrator or HR Assistant).Understanding of HR processes such as onboarding, Right to Work, and references.Experience using HR systems (HRIS and ATS); knowledge of iTrent is an advantage.Strong IT skills, including Word, Excel, and Teams.Exceptional attention to detail and ability to process large volumes of work accurately.Excellent organisational skills and ability to prioritise under pressure.A proactive, ‘can do’ attitude and willingness to support team goals.Who we are:Activate Learning is a pioneering education group with a global reach, committed to transforming lives through our approach to learning.We see our employees as individuals, empowering them to make the right choices for their ambitions and careers.
